Thanks to Erasure and that bloody Bjorn Again thing, Abba have been increasingly ghettoised into this whole Gay thing. Very different to when I was growing up and it seemed as though every 2.4 children household had a copy of Arrival. It was as commonplace as finding white dogshit and wearing disco rollerskates back then. Now the media seem set on casting them as this Eurotrash camp thing, which wasn't the case at all, once.

Like Glice, I could never trust anyone that truly hated Abba. I'd say the same about the Bee Gees too. Forget 'Stayin' Alive', who could deny the ethereal splendour of something like 'How Deep is Your Love'. Pure sonic magic! Almost like a tone poem. Ditto Blondie's 'Heart of Glass' (still the greatest song created by humankind).
